Do all patients diagnosed with Mitral Valve Prolapse require immediate surgery?

Most patients with mitral valve prolapse do not require immediate surgery. This condition is often benign. It affects approximately 2% of people worldwide. Doctors only recommend surgery if the prolapse causes severe blood leakage. Treatment focuses on long-term monitoring through regular echocardiograms.

  • Surgical triggers: Surgery is necessary for severe mitral regurgitation.
  • Heart strain: Intervention occurs if the left ventricular ejection fraction drops.
  • Complication management: New-onset atrial fibrillation or pulmonary hypertension requires immediate evaluation.
  • Conservative care: Many patients manage symptoms with beta-blockers for palpitations.

Is mitral valve repair preferred over replacement in Lithuanian clinics?

Lithuanian cardiac centers like Meliva Kardiolita Hospital in Vilnius prioritize mitral valve repair over replacement. Surgeons follow European Society of Cardiology guidelines to preserve natural tissue. This approach avoids lifelong blood thinners. It also ensures higher survival rates for patients with mitral valve prolapse.

  • Guidelines adherence: Lithuanian specialists strictly follow international European Society of Cardiology standards.
  • Survival outcomes: Preserving native valve anatomy results in superior long-term survival rates.
  • Medication benefits: Successful repair eliminates the need for lifelong anticoagulant therapy.
  • Structural integrity: Maintaining natural valve architecture prevents future heart dilation and complications.

Are minimally invasive options available for MVP repair in Lithuania?

Lithuania offers minimally invasive options for mitral valve prolapse repair. Specialist centers use small incisions instead of traditional sternotomy. Techniques include right mini-thoracotomy and video-assisted endoscopic repair. These methods help treat mitral regurgitation through incisions as small as 4 cm.

  • Surgical access: Surgeons use a 4–5 cm incision between the ribs.
  • Advanced optics: High-definition 3D thoracoscopy provides a magnified view.
  • Valve preservation: Specialists use annuloplasty rings and synthetic cords.
  • Recovery times: Patients often return to activities within 2 weeks.

What should patients with complex anatomical features like Barlow's Disease ask their Lithuanian surgeon?

Patients with Barlow Disease should ask Lithuanian surgeons about their personal repair success rates for multi-segment prolapse. Targeted questions must cover specific techniques like artificial chordae placement and annuloplasty ring selection. These details ensure the surgeon can manage complex leaflet redundancy while avoiding valve replacement.

  • Success metrics: Ask for personal Barlow-specific repair rates rather than general hospital statistics.
  • Technical approach: Inquire about the choice between leaflet resection or using PTFE neochords.
  • Complication prevention: Ask how the surgeon plans to mitigate Systolic Anterior Motion risks.
  • Imaging protocols: Confirm if the center utilizes intraoperative 3D transesophageal echocardiography for assessment.

What is the typical recovery and hospital stay structure in Lithuania?

Lithuania employs a structured recovery approach for mitral valve treatment. Patients typically spend 5 to 10 days in the hospital. This starts with 1 to 2 days of ICU monitoring. Recovery follows an organized three-stage model ensuring continuous cardiac rehabilitation from bedside to home.

  • Intensive monitoring: Patients stay 48 hours for stabilization in intensive care units.
  • Cardiac ward: Patients transfer to wards for rhythm monitoring and mobility checks.
  • Stage 2 rehab: Specialized inpatient units provide physiotherapy for 20 days if required.
  • Acute care stay: Surgical treatments in Lithuania average 7.9 days for acute recovery.
